grubby-bls: make "id" be the filename, and include it in --info=ALL

Related: rhbz#1638103
Signed-off-by: Peter Jones <pjones@redhat.com>
This commit is contained in:
Peter Jones 2018-10-23 15:08:30 +02:00 committed by Javier Martinez Canillas
parent 33ab171b28
commit 4aa091811b
No known key found for this signature in database
GPG Key ID: C751E590D63F3D69
1 changed files with 3 additions and 1 deletions

View File

@ -89,7 +89,8 @@ get_bls_values() {
bls_linux[$count]="$(get_bls_value ${bls} linux)"
bls_initrd[$count]="$(get_bls_value ${bls} initrd)"
bls_options[$count]="$(get_bls_value ${bls} options)"
bls_id[$count]="$(get_bls_value ${bls} id)"
bls_id[$count]="${bls%.conf}"
bls_id[$count]="${bls_id[$count]##*/}"
count=$((count+1))
done
@ -193,6 +194,7 @@ display_info_values() {
echo "args=\"${bls_options[$i]}\""
echo "initrd=${bls_initrd[$i]}"
echo "title=${bls_title[$i]}"
echo "id=\"${bls_id[$i]}\""
done
exit 0
}